☐ **Set up access to the Willowmere interview room (2.14).** This is the secure room we use for candidate interviews and the odd HR chat, so it stays locked at all times. Facilities desk: walk the new starter over on day one, show them the booking tablet outside the door, and remind them not to wedge it open between sessions — yes, it happens. Blinds stay down during interviews. They'll need the door code to get in, which is noted below.

staff pass of kawip-hawef = bdg-QLP-2

## Changelog — 2.9.1: Signing key rotation

This maintenance release of the Corvanto Pagination API rotates the artifact signing key as part of our scheduled annual rotation. Cursor-based pagination behavior is unchanged; no endpoint contracts were modified. Future maintainers should note that all SDK bundles published after this release are signed with the new key, and the previous key remains valid for verification of historical artifacts only until the next quarterly purge. The new signing key follows below.

release key, yagap-kagag: bky6_1ks93y

- [ ] **Step 7: Breaker override escrow.** After sealing the signing keys for the Tallgrove upstream API circuit breaker, confirm the support team can force the breaker open during a full outage. The override bundle lives in the sealed escrow drawer and is useless without its unlock phrase. Two ceremony witnesses must initial this step before proceeding. The escrow bundle is decrypted with the recovery passphrase that follows.

vault phrase of kahip-kahop = holath-quenmir

# Gatewick rate limiting — notes for weekly eng sync
# Current limits: 200 req/min per service token, burst 40.
# RATE_WINDOW_SECS and RATE_BURST below control both; changes need a sync sign-off.
# Last week's incident: limiter fail-open when the counter store dropped. Fix shipped;
# limiter now fails closed. Watch the 429 dashboard after deploys.
# The limiter authenticates to the counter store with a shared secret.
# That secret is set on the next line.

secret setting of fadup-yafop: LEDGER_TOKEN29=4fd374a7288a369f7cc9d4c14484e